True first edition published by Random House with the numbers '24689753' and 'first edition' stated. Dustjacket is a true first state without the Random House audio quote on the back flap that is found on the 2nd state dust jacket. Book is AS NEW. DJ is AS NEW. DJ price reads '$24.95.'
